SUBSTANTIAL HOLDINGS IN EESTI TELEKOM

On December 9 2002, Telia AB and Sonera Corporation (hereinafter: Sonera)
merged after conclusion of swap offer for shares and securities. After the
transaction Sonera became subsidiary of Telia AB. Telia AB was renamed
TeliaSonera AB.

Before merger both Telia AB and Sonera owned directly and through Baltic
Tele AB 24.5% of AS Eesti Telekom (hereinafter: ETL) shares. Telia and
Sonera both own 50% of Baltic Tele AB shares.

Shareholders' structure of ETL shares was as follows:

Republic of Estonia - 27.28 % of shares;
Telia AB - 11.75 % of shares;
Sonera Holding B.V. - 11.75 % of shares;
Baltic Tele AB - 25.50 % of shares;
public investors - 23.72 % of shares.

As a result of merger Telia AB shareholding in ETL grew from 24.5 percent
to 49 percent.

Proceeding from subsection 1 of chapter 185 of the Securities Market Act
TeliaSonera AB informed on December 23, 2002 through its representative
the registrar maintaining ETL share register that TeliaSonera AB holding
in ETL grew over one third (1/3) of all ETL shares with voting rights.

TeliaSonera AB has holding and controlling in 67,317,756 of ETL voting rights.
